#74e84e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#74e84e is composed of 45.5% red, 91%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.4%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 105.2 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 60.8%. #74e84e color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ff9c with #00d100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#74e84e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050e02 is the darkest color, while #fcf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#74e84e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9b9b is the less saturated color, while #6cf73f is the most saturated one.
